Patents by Inventor Anoop Dawani

Anoop Dawani has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11936558
    Abstract: Systems and methods are provided for evaluation of networks and changes thereto using automated analysis of network models. The automated analysis can be used to determine how to implement and mutate networks efficiently and effectively, to determine whether and why network resources are unable to communicate with each other, and the like. Automated analysis can allow users (e.g., network administrators) to define networks and pose changes to networks using high-level policies (e.g., written in a declarative language), have those polices automatically translated to lower-level implementation operations for analysis, and in some cases have results of the analysis presented back to the users in an easy-to-understand form.
    Type: Grant
    Filed: December 10, 2021
    Date of Patent: March 19, 2024
    Assignee: Amazon Technologies, Inc.
    Inventors: Baihu Qian, Bashuman Deb, Justin Lin Hsieh, Daniel William Dacosta, Nick Matthews, Anoop Dawani, Omer Hashmi, Thomas Nguyen Spendley, Viktor Heorhiadi
  • Patent number: 11855893
    Abstract: Systems and methods are provided for management of network segments that cross geographic regions and/or other types of network divisions in a cloud-based network environment. A cloud-based network provider's geographically-dispersed network infrastructure may serve as the core of a client's private wide area network, and the client may define isolated segments to which other networks (virtual private clouds, virtual private networks, etc.) may be attached. The various segments may remain logically isolated from each other even when implemented across some or all of the same regions—and using the same physical and/or virtual routing components—as other segments of the same client and/or other clients.
    Type: Grant
    Filed: November 24, 2021
    Date of Patent: December 26, 2023
    Assignee: Amazon Technologies, Inc.
    Inventors: Anoop Dawani, Bashuman Deb, Baihu Qian, Omer Hashmi, Nick Matthews, Shridhar Kulkarni, Thomas Nguyen Spendley, Steve Ge, Justin Lin Hsieh, Guru Kannan, Alok Mishra
  • Patent number: 11824773
    Abstract: A pair of virtual routers is configured. In response to programmatic requests, dynamic transfer of routing information between the routers in accordance with configuration settings indicated by a client is enabled. The routing information is associated with a set of isolated networks to which the virtual routers are attached. A network packet originating at an address in a first isolated network is transmitted to an address in a second isolated network using a route determined from routing information transmitted between the virtual routers according to the configuration settings.
    Type: Grant
    Filed: March 30, 2021
    Date of Patent: November 21, 2023
    Assignee: Amazon Technologies, Inc.
    Inventors: Baihu Qian, Omer Hashmi, Thomas Nguyen Spendley, Bashuman Deb, Shridhar Kulkarni, Paul John Tillotson, Indira Radhika Pulla, Ramin Ali Dousti, Nicholas Ryan Lombardi, Steve Ge, Nick Matthews, Anoop Dawani
  • Patent number: 11799755
    Abstract: Systems and methods are provided for management of network segments that cross geographic regions and/or other types of network divisions in a cloud-based network environment. Gateway may manage traffic across regions using routing metadata that includes a segment identifier. The gateways may also signal their routes across regions based on segment data, and implement the signaled routes using segment-based routing policies. Route selection may be performed using optimization data.
    Type: Grant
    Filed: November 24, 2021
    Date of Patent: October 24, 2023
    Assignee: Amazon Technologies, Inc.
    Inventors: Anoop Dawani, Bashuman Deb, Baihu Qian, Omer Hashmi, Nick Matthews, Shridhar Kulkarni, Thomas Nguyen Spendley, Indira Radhika Pulla, David Jonathan Adams, Nicholas Ryan Lombardi, Brandon Michael LaRue, Aaron Scott DeBruin, Ramin Ali Dousti
  • Patent number: 11792116
    Abstract: Disclosed are various embodiments of a stateful network router. In one embodiment, a network data connection is intercepted between a first host and a second host on a network. First data packets from the network data connection sent by the first host to the second host are routed to a target network appliance. Second data packets from the network data connection sent by the second host to the first host are also to the target network appliance.
    Type: Grant
    Filed: August 4, 2021
    Date of Patent: October 17, 2023
    Assignee: AMAZON TECHNOLOGIES, INC.
    Inventors: Andrew Bruce Dickinson, Anoop Dawani, Joseph Elmar Magerramov, Nishant Mehta, Lee Spencer Dillard
  • Publication number: 20230188598
    Abstract: Techniques are described that enable users to configure the mirroring of network traffic sent to or received by computing resources associated with a virtual network of computing resources at a service provider network. The mirrored network traffic can be used for many different purposes including, for example, network traffic content inspection, forensic and threat analysis, network troubleshooting, data loss prevention, and the like. Users can configure such network traffic mirroring without the need to manually install and manage network capture agents or other such processes on each computing resource for which network traffic mirroring is desired. Users can cause mirrored network traffic to be stored at a storage service in the form of packet capture (or “pcap”) files, which can be used by any number of available out-of-band security and monitoring appliances including other user-specific monitoring tools and/or other services of the service provider network.
    Type: Application
    Filed: January 30, 2023
    Publication date: June 15, 2023
    Applicant: Amazon Technologies, Inc.
    Inventors: Anoop DAWANI, Nishant MEHTA, Richard H. GALLIHER, Lee Spencer DILLARD, Joseph Elmar MAGERRAMOV
  • Publication number: 20230179517
    Abstract: An indication of a set of premises between which network traffic is to be routed via a private fiber backbone of a provider network is obtained. Respective virtual routers are configured for a first premise and a second premise, and connectivity is established between the virtual routers and routing information sources at the premises. Contents of at least one network packet originating at the first premise are transmitted to the second premise via the private fiber backbone using routing information obtained at the virtual routers from the routing information source at the second premise.
    Type: Application
    Filed: January 27, 2023
    Publication date: June 8, 2023
    Applicant: Amazon Technologies, Inc.
    Inventors: Baihu Qian, Omer Hashmi, Thomas Nguyen Spendley, Bashuman Deb, Shridhar Kulkarni, Paul John Tillotson, Ramin Ali Dousti, Indira Radhika Pulla, Steve Ge, Nicholas Ryan Lombardi, Nick Matthews, Anoop Dawani
  • Patent number: 11601365
    Abstract: An indication of a set of premises between which network traffic is to be routed via a private fiber backbone of a provider network is obtained. Respective virtual routers are configured for a first premise and a second premise, and connectivity is established between the virtual routers and routing information sources at the premises. Contents of at least one network packet originating at the first premise are transmitted to the second premise via the private fiber backbone using routing information obtained at the virtual routers from the routing information source at the second premise.
    Type: Grant
    Filed: March 30, 2021
    Date of Patent: March 7, 2023
    Assignee: Amazon Technologies, Inc.
    Inventors: Baihu Qian, Omer Hashmi, Thomas Nguyen Spendley, Bashuman Deb, Shridhar Kulkarni, Paul John Tillotson, Ramin Ali Dousti, Indira Radhika Pulla, Steve Ge, Nicholas Ryan Lombardi, Nick Matthews, Anoop Dawani
  • Patent number: 11570244
    Abstract: Techniques are described that enable users to configure the mirroring of network traffic sent to or received by computing resources associated with a virtual network of computing resources at a service provider network. The mirrored network traffic can be used for many different purposes including, for example, network traffic content inspection, forensic and threat analysis, network troubleshooting, data loss prevention, and the like. Users can configure such network traffic mirroring without the need to manually install and manage network capture agents or other such processes on each computing resource for which network traffic mirroring is desired. Users can cause mirrored network traffic to be stored at a storage service in the form of packet capture (or “pcap”) files, which can be used by any number of available out-of-band security and monitoring appliances including other user-specific monitoring tools and/or other services of the service provider network.
    Type: Grant
    Filed: December 11, 2018
    Date of Patent: January 31, 2023
    Assignee: Amazon Technologies, Inc.
    Inventors: Anoop Dawani, Nishant Mehta, Richard H. Galliher, Lee Spencer Dillard, Joseph Elmar Magerramov
  • Patent number: 11516050
    Abstract: Technologies are disclosed for monitoring network traffic using traffic mirroring. According to some examples, traffic mirroring allows customers to monitor traffic at different sources within a VPC. For example, a source may be any Elastic Network Interface (ENI) in their VPC, including elastic network interfaces (ENIs) on virtual machine instances, Network Address Translation (NAT) Gateways, Load Balancers, VPC endpoints, Internal Gateways, Transit Gateways, and more. Filters can be utilized to determine the network traffic to mirror. A customer may also configure to monitor real-time traffic with a monitoring appliance of their choice. With traffic mirroring, data traffic may be identified and sent to one or more target devices. Customers may monitor traffic within a VPC for content inspection, forensic analysis, troubleshooting, record keeping, and the like.
    Type: Grant
    Filed: September 23, 2019
    Date of Patent: November 29, 2022
    Assignee: Amazon Technologies, Inc.
    Inventors: Anoop Dawani, Joseph Elmar Magerramov, Zachary Brandes, Apoorv Mittal, Bharadwaj Avva, Ryan James Schaefer, Kiran Venkat Sayeeram Karpurapu, Ajay Jha, Steven Bruce Richards, Richard H Galliher
  • Publication number: 20220321471
    Abstract: A message indicating an auxiliary task associated with traffic transmitted via a virtual router between a pair of isolated networks is received at an offloading device. A stack multiplexer at the offloading device selects a protocol stack instance to process the message. A result of the auxiliary task is obtained by the multiplexer from the selected protocol stack instance and transmitted to the virtual router, where it is used to transmit a packet between the isolated networks.
    Type: Application
    Filed: March 30, 2021
    Publication date: October 6, 2022
    Applicant: Amazon Technologies, Inc.
    Inventors: Bashuman Deb, Omer Hashmi, Thomas Nguyen Spendley, Baihu Qian, Guru Kannan, Shridhar Kulkarni, Paul John Tillotson, Ramin Ali Dousti, Indira Radhika Pulla, Yuxin Ren, Fahed Hijazi, Xiyuan Gou, Steve Ge, Nicholas Ryan Lombardi, Brandon Michael LaRue, Jaywant U. Kapadnis, Anoop Dawani
  • Publication number: 20220321469
    Abstract: A pair of virtual routers is configured. In response to programmatic requests, dynamic transfer of routing information between the routers in accordance with configuration settings indicated by a client is enabled. The routing information is associated with a set of isolated networks to which the virtual routers are attached. A network packet originating at an address in a first isolated network is transmitted to an address in a second isolated network using a route determined from routing information transmitted between the virtual routers according to the configuration settings.
    Type: Application
    Filed: March 30, 2021
    Publication date: October 6, 2022
    Applicant: Amazon Technologies, Inc.
    Inventors: Baihu Qian, Omer Hashmi, Thomas Nguyen Spendley, Bashuman Deb, Shridhar Kulkarni, Paul John Tillotson, Indira Radhika Pulla, Ramin Ali Dousti, Nicholas Ryan Lombardi, Steve Ge, Nick Matthews, Anoop Dawani
  • Publication number: 20220321470
    Abstract: An indication of a set of premises between which network traffic is to be routed via a private fiber backbone of a provider network is obtained. Respective virtual routers are configured for a first premise and a second premise, and connectivity is established between the virtual routers and routing information sources at the premises. Contents of at least one network packet originating at the first premise are transmitted to the second premise via the private fiber backbone using routing information obtained at the virtual routers from the routing information source at the second premise.
    Type: Application
    Filed: March 30, 2021
    Publication date: October 6, 2022
    Applicant: Amazon Technologies, Inc.
    Inventors: Baihu Qian, Omer Hashmi, Thomas Nguyen Spendley, Bashuman Deb, Shridhar Kulkarni, Paul John Tillotson, Ramin Ali Dousti, Indira Radhika Pulla, Steve Ge, Nicholas Ryan Lombardi, Nick Matthews, Anoop Dawani
  • Patent number: 11411771
    Abstract: Techniques for networking in provider network substrate extensions are described. A compute instance of an isolated virtual network is hosted by an extension of a provider network that is in communication with the provider network via a secure tunnel through a customer network. A request to establish communications between the isolated virtual network and the customer network is received at an interface to the provider network. A message to cause a gateway of the extension to route traffic between the isolated virtual network and the customer network is sent via the secure tunnel.
    Type: Grant
    Filed: June 28, 2019
    Date of Patent: August 9, 2022
    Assignee: Amazon Technologies, Inc.
    Inventors: Anoop Dawani, Joseph Elmar Magerramov, David James Goodell, Richard H. Galliher
  • Patent number: 11206207
    Abstract: Managed multicast communications may be implemented across isolated networks. A virtual traffic hub may be implemented that connects different isolated networks. A control plane for the virtual traffic hub may accept requests to enable a multicast group between different isolated networks connected to the virtual traffic hub. The multicast group may then be enabled at the virtual traffic hub so that requests to add members to the multicast group and data packets directed to the multicast group can be handled according to multicast protocols by the virtual traffic hub.
    Type: Grant
    Filed: January 29, 2019
    Date of Patent: December 21, 2021
    Assignee: Amazon Technologies, Inc.
    Inventors: Bashuman Deb, Anoop Dawani, Colm MacCarthaigh
  • Patent number: 11115322
    Abstract: Disclosed are various embodiments of a stateful network router. In one embodiment, a stateful network router intercepts a network data connection between a first host and a second host on a network. The stateful network router routes first data packets from the network data connection sent by the first host to the second host to a target. The stateful network router also routes second data packets from the network data connection sent by the second host to the first host to the target.
    Type: Grant
    Filed: March 27, 2019
    Date of Patent: September 7, 2021
    Assignee: Amazon Technologies, Inc.
    Inventors: Andrew Bruce Dickinson, Anoop Dawani, Joseph Elmar Magerramov, Nishant Mehta, Lee Spencer Dillard
  • Publication number: 20200403826
    Abstract: Technologies are disclosed for monitoring network traffic using traffic mirroring. According to some examples, traffic mirroring allows customers to monitor traffic at different sources within a VPC. For example, a source may be any Elastic Network Interface (ENI) in their VPC, including elastic network interfaces (ENIs) on virtual machine instances, Network Address Translation (NAT) Gateways, Load Balancers, VPC endpoints, Internal Gateways, Transit Gateways, and more. Filters can be utilized to determine the network traffic to mirror. A customer may also configure to monitor real-time traffic with a monitoring appliance of their choice. With traffic mirroring, data traffic may be identified and sent to one or more target devices. Customers may monitor traffic within a VPC for content inspection, forensic analysis, troubleshooting, record keeping, and the like.
    Type: Application
    Filed: September 23, 2019
    Publication date: December 24, 2020
    Inventors: Anoop Dawani, Joseph Elmar Magerramov, Zachary Brandes, Apoorv Mittal, Bharadwaj Avva, Ryan James Schaefer, Kiran Venkat Sayeeram Karpurapu, Ajay Jha, Steven Bruce Richards, Richard H Galliher
  • Publication number: 20200186600
    Abstract: Techniques are described that enable users to configure the mirroring of network traffic sent to or received by computing resources associated with a virtual network of computing resources at a service provider network. The mirrored network traffic can be used for many different purposes including, for example, network traffic content inspection, forensic and threat analysis, network troubleshooting, data loss prevention, and the like. Users can configure such network traffic mirroring without the need to manually install and manage network capture agents or other such processes on each computing resource for which network traffic mirroring is desired. Users can cause mirrored network traffic to be stored at a storage service in the form of packet capture (or “pcap”) files, which can be used by any number of available out-of-band security and monitoring appliances including other user-specific monitoring tools and/or other services of the service provider network.
    Type: Application
    Filed: December 11, 2018
    Publication date: June 11, 2020
    Inventors: Anoop DAWANI, Nishant MEHTA, Richard H. GALLIHER, Lee Spencer DILLARD, Joseph Elmar MAGERRAMOV
  • Patent number: 10469595
    Abstract: A method and apparatus of a network element that dynamically establishes a first virtual private network (VPN) tunnel is described. In an exemplary embodiment, the network element detects data destined for a first private subnet. In response to the detecting, the network element determines that a next hop for the data does not have an established VPN tunnel that allows access to the first private subnet. The network element further establishes the VPN tunnel and sends the data using the VPN tunnel.
    Type: Grant
    Filed: February 17, 2017
    Date of Patent: November 5, 2019
    Assignee: ARISTA NETWORKS, INC.
    Inventors: Anoop Dawani, James Michael Murphy, Udayakumar Srinivasan
  • Publication number: 20180241823
    Abstract: A method and apparatus of a network element that dynamically establishes a first virtual private network (VPN) tunnel is described. In an exemplary embodiment, the network element detects data destined for a first private subnet. In response to the detecting, the network element determines that a next hop for the data does not have an established VPN tunnel that allows access to the first private subnet. The network element further establishes the VPN tunnel and sends the data using the VPN tunnel.
    Type: Application
    Filed: February 17, 2017
    Publication date: August 23, 2018
    Inventors: Anoop Dawani, James Michael Murphy, Udayakumar Srinivasan